Opcode: <2A01h>

Command a Demodulator’s Frequency

<4>

Frequency

Unsigned Binary Value in Hz


Opcode: <2A02h>

Command a Demodulator’s Data Rate

<4>

Data Rate

Unsigned Binary Value in BPS


Opcode: <2A04h>

Command a Demodulator’s Sweep Boundary

<1>

Sweep Boundary

Set in 1 kHz Steps (Max of 42 kHz)
